CANTEX DRILLS 22.5m of 1.96 g/t, 12m of 2.1 g/t, 6m of 3.55 g/t and 2m of 8.31 g/t GOLD in HOLE RDH-H

KELOWNA, BC, Nov. 28, 2011 /CNW/ - Cantex Mine Development Corp. (CD : TSXV) ("Cantex" or the "Company") is pleased to announce drilling results from its Al Hariqah gold project.

Results for a further 7 holes from the Al Hariqah gold project have been received. Upper portions of the holes are typically drilled using percussion techniques and the holes are then extended with core drilling. Sample results are pending from 7 additional holes.

Drilling at the Al Hariqah project continues to intersect gold mineralization over significant lengths. Hole RDH-H intersected 22.5 meters of 1.96 g/t gold from a depth of 55.5 meters depth. This mineralization lies within a larger zone which averages 1.05 g/t gold over 81 meters from a depth of 1 meter. Several additional zones of significant gold were intersected deeper in the hole including 12 meters of 2.1 g/t gold from 108 meters depth, 6 meters of 3.55 g/t gold from 125 meters depth and 2 meters of 8.31 g/t gold from 142 meters depth.

As seen in the above table, shallower portions of hole RDH-I, which had previously been drilled, intersected numerous zones of gold mineralization including 6 meters of 2.09 g/t gold from 54 meters depth. Results from the recently completed core drilling of this hole extended the mineralization including 22.67 meters of 1.24 g/t gold from 85.5 meters depth.

Hole RDH-K intersected 91 meters of 0.68 g/t gold from 3 meters depth.
